Subject: Partner SFTP drop — new owner

Hi,

As you review the pending changes to the Harborline ingest scripts, note that ownership of the partner SFTP drop is changing at the end of the month. This includes key rotation, the nightly pull job, and the quarantine folder for malformed files. Review comments on the retry logic should still go through the normal PR flow, but questions about drop-folder conventions or partner onboarding now go to the new owner. The incoming owner is listed below.

signatory, tagaf-bahaf: Praael Fenmir Rusok

## Service Accounts — Quillpress Invoice Renderer

Welcome aboard! The PDF invoice renderer runs under the `quillpress-render` service account, which only has read access to billing templates and write access to the output bucket. Don't reuse it for anything else — we've been burned before. To run the renderer locally against staging, export the internal rendering API key shown below.

API key for yahig-tadup: kto7_ubizbYm

**Building Access — Night Shift**

Bike cage at Harlow Court locks at 22:00. Use the side reader, not the roller gate. Parking gates on Level B run on a timer; after midnight they stay down and need manual release from the hut. Log every release in the gate book. For the cage reader and the pedestrian gate, enter the code below.

turnstile pass: bdg-FVNQRS-72965873